Super Mario Odyssey has dropped its price significantly, now available at 50% off for $29.99 on the Nintendo Switch at Best Buy. This marks a return to Black Friday-level discounts for one of the platform's most notable titles. The game's reappearance at this reduced price offers an excellent opportunity for both longtime fans and newcomers to experience its innovative gameplay, featuring Mario's ally Cappy, who allows transformation into various characters and objects, enhancing exploration across diverse worlds.
Originally released alongside The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ild in the Nintendo Switch's first year, Super Mario Odyssey earned critical acclaim. IGN awarded it a perfect score, praising it as a "brilliant adventure" that pays homage to classic Nintendo games. Its recent update on the Switch 2 further enhances visual quality and adds HDR support, making it look better than ever on televisions.
The game's enduring appeal lies in its creativity and depth, setting it apart as one of the best 3D platformers available today.
